16 September 2004 - 23:54

wind fall

Just office work today. I would have enjoyed the training session on CWD sampling, but it was just too hard to justify the four hours of driving to learn what I already know.

First high point of the day? Going out in the back yard with the heelers to collect the wind fallen sloe under the wild plum trees. Only one has actually got any ripe fruit on it, and not enough that you can just grab handfuls and indulge yourself.

No, you have to pace yourself and savor each one. Limiting your take to what has already fallen on the ground.

With maybe an occassional light shake of the tree when it isn't being properly generous.

Second high point of the day?

Visiting with Melissa on the phone, while listening to the wind and rain in the background as Morgan made their final preparations for Ivan.

Never talked to anyone in the middle of a hurricane before.
